Library
The academic library is the place to find information in an academic environment. Its purpose is to support and promote the teaching and research work of the Institute. The institute’s library is designed and functions as an ergonomic, flexible, and open to modern needs of the academic and research staff, members of the academic community, the Foundation and the broader society establishment.
The main library is in operation since 1988 and has a collection of over 32,000 volumes. It subscribes to 17 electronic sources (on-line databases, digital libraries, statistical databases, etc.) and provides access to 550 scientific journals. The study room area is 800 m2, has seating capacity for 200 people and provides access to 22 computers. In comparison with other ITs, the library in Kavala is ranked 6th in number of books. There are also libraries on the Drama and Didymoteicho campuses. The institutes research, learning and training activities requires:

The goals of the library are:
• Research, identify, evaluate and purchase materials and access to sources of information.
• The organisation of the maternal to be easily searched, identified and used by users.
• Provide education to better use the list of collections (OPAC) and electronic services (databases, electronic journals).
• Participation in collaborative groups (Catalogue of Greek Academic Libraries-HEAL-LINK).
